Some feedback on Q&A talent subjects:

It’s really nice to get talent here promoting a book that’s about to come out. But, speaking as a fan… that is not the most useful time to have someone for a Q&A. We haven’t actually read the comic yet, so we can’t ask them our questions about it. We certainly can’t ask them for spoilers about what’s GOING to happen. So very little information that is actually useful or enlightening to a comic fan ends up being exchanged. I would like to request that future Q&A subjects should be in a position to speak about a work, or works, which are already accessible to the community.
